What Types of Work and Facilities Can Home Health Occupational Therapists Expect in Sacramento, CA?

As a Home Health Occupational Therapist in Sacramento, California, you can expect to engage in diverse and fulfilling work that directly impacts patients’ lives in their own homes. Your role will primarily focus on assessing and enhancing patients’ functional abilities, helping them regain independence through personalized therapy plans and interventions. You’ll collaborate with interdisciplinary teams, including nurses and social workers, to provide comprehensive care for patients recovering from surgeries, managing chronic conditions, or adjusting to disabilities. In addition to direct patient care, you may also provide education and training to caregivers and families, helping them understand therapeutic techniques and strategies for supporting their loved ones. With a variety of home settings ranging from urban apartments to rural residences, you will encounter a rich tapestry of community members, each presenting unique challenges and opportunities for meaningful rehabilitation.

As a traveler in this home health OT role, you will provide one-on-one, patient-centered care in the comfort of patients’ homes across the valley and surrounding rural areas. You can expect a caseload primarily consisting of adult and geriatric patients with a range of diagnoses, including post-orthopedic surgery, neurologic conditions, cardiopulmonary disease, deconditioning, and chronic illness management. Typical responsibilities include initial and follow-up assessments, development and progression of individualized care plans, home safety and fall risk evaluations, ADL and IADL training, energy conservation strategies, adaptive equipment and DME recommendations, and caregiver education. A typical day includes driving between patient homes throughout the Santa Ynez Valley, managing a schedule of several visits per day depending on evaluation versus treatment mix. Visit types may include start-of-care assessments, routine treatment visits, recertifications, and discharges. You will collaborate with an interdisciplinary home health team that may include nurses, physical therapists, speech therapists, medical social workers, and home health aides. Communication is generally coordinated via phone, secure messaging, and EMR documentation, with supportive clinical leadership to assist with complex cases. Shifts are generally daytime, Monday through Friday, with some flexibility to accommodate patient and therapist scheduling needs. Weekend or evening work, if needed, is typically limited and planned in advance. Documentation is completed electronically, and you will be expected to manage your time effectively to balance travel, patient care, and timely charting. The home health agency is traveler-friendly and accustomed to integrating contract clinicians into their workflows. You can expect a structured orientation to the service area, EMR system, and documentation standards, along with ongoing support from clinical supervisors. The territory is designed to be manageable, with an effort to cluster visits geographically whenever possible to minimize driving time and maximize patient-facing care. In this role, you will provide one-on-one, patient-centered Occupational Therapy services in the home setting for adults and older adults who are recovering from illness, injury, or surgery, or managing chronic conditions. You will travel to patient homes throughout Kirkland and nearby communities, using your clinical skills to help individuals regain independence and safely perform everyday activities in their own environment. This setting offers a meaningful opportunity to see the direct impact of your interventions on a patient’s daily life, with a focus on functional outcomes, safety, and quality of life. Typical responsibilities include conducting comprehensive occupational therapy evaluations in the home, identifying functional limitations and environmental barriers, and developing individualized treatment plans. You will implement interventions such as ADL training, energy conservation techniques, balance and coordination exercises, home safety modifications, and equipment recommendations. You will provide patient and caregiver education, coordinate services with nursing, physical therapy, speech therapy, home health aides, and medical social work, and contribute to overall interdisciplinary care planning to support safe transitions and reduce rehospitalization risk. Your day-to-day work will involve managing a field-based caseload, traveling between homes, completing timely EMR documentation, and communicating with the broader care team. Visit volume and patient ratios are designed to support thorough, high-quality care and appropriate time for assessment, treatment, and documentation. You will work within established home health guidelines and regulatory standards, ensuring accurate OASIS or other required assessments, and adhering to infection control and safety protocols in diverse home environments. Shifts typically follow daytime hours with some flexibility to support patient needs and route efficiency. The role allows for a degree of autonomy and independence, while still providing support from clinical leaders and colleagues experienced in home health. In this role, you will provide comprehensive home health occupational therapy services to adult patients in their homes within the Anchorage area and surrounding communities. This is a 13-week contract assignment with an ASAP start date. The schedule is Monday through Friday, 8:00am to 5:00pm, with no on-call requirements, and an expected 40 hours per week under a guaranteed work week structure. Your typical day will include traveling to patient homes, performing functional and environmental assessments, developing and implementing individualized plans of care, and documenting visits using OASIS and the facility’s EMR. You will focus on improving safety, independence, and quality of life for patients who may be recovering from surgery, managing chronic conditions, or living with functional limitations. Responsibilities commonly include ADL and IADL training, energy conservation strategies, home safety evaluations, recommendations for durable medical equipment, and caregiver education. You will collaborate with an interdisciplinary team that may include nurses, physical therapists, speech therapists, social workers, and other professionals to support coordinated, patient-centered care. Patient volume and caseload are structured to align with a standard full-time home health schedule, allowing you to plan your day around travel time, visit durations, and documentation needs. You can expect a mix of evaluation and follow-up visits, with opportunities to develop strong therapeutic relationships as you see patients in their own environments. This role offers meaningful autonomy, as you will use clinical judgment to adjust treatment plans, identify safety concerns, and coordinate with the broader care team to achieve optimal outcomes.
